Scientifically Speaking
I really enjoyed this game. Being scientifically accurate right down to the 4 nitrogenous bases and the process of mitosis, I salute you for keeping true to the roots. I found the game play simple, It was easy to learn but hard to master.
The evolution game mechanism was a ground breaker too, allowing different combinations which, for me, leads to different distinctions of cellular classes; from specialized gatherers to brutal prong attackers.
The AI is also formidable, I noticed that the AI found the same class distinctions as I do, where small cells gather and medium/large cells attack and defend. I also noticed that they attack in groups and not by trickling in cell by cell
"God" powers are one of the things that I enjoyed. From spawning more food to radioactive cobalt ( scientifically accurate ). It required one to think before they act. I once used the cobalt on the enemy and backfired as it turns out that a simple gatherer transformed into a freak of nature.
However, this game is not exactly perfect, it lack the ability to zoom in and out of the battlefield ( which was ironic as you are looking through a microscope ) and the ability to pan with the mouse. Also the graphics were not what I call high end and the sounds are simple. Also, without the ability to auto-retaliate. Defending can be quite a chore.
